WebThe orchid can grow but will not bloom if there is no temperature swing between day and night. In our homes, where the temperature tends to rise rather than fall at night due to heating systems, this can be a serious concern because it is opposite to the orchid’s natural environment. One common approach is called "weakly weekly", where you basically add a very dilute amount of fertilizer into the water each time you water the plants during their active growth season (s). Typically you use 1/8 to 1/4 the recommended dose.

WebAug 20, 2024 · PLACE YOUR ORCHIDS OUTSIDE If your weather permits, place your orchids outside in the shade and let Mother Nature do the work for you. Having a drop in temperature at night for a few weeks will often cause your plant to bloom. WebJun 24, 2024 · Orchids can experience bud blast—a condition where the flower buds drop without blooming. This is usually caused by sudden changes in temperature, humidity, moisture, or fertilizer. WebJul 12, 2024 · What’s Normal Orchid Bloom Loss? A natural orchid cycle typically sees leaf growth in summer and early fall, a bloom spike in late fall or early winter, and then blooming in early spring. First, cut off the old flower stalk at the base of the plant. Then put your moth orchid in a room in your house that simulates the conditions that will cause it to flower again.
